  1. The Refreshments were an alternative rock band from Tempe, Arizona. The band is best known for the single " Banditos " from their 1996 breakthrough album Fizzy Fuzzy Big & Buzzy , and also for " Yahoos and Triangles ", the theme song to the long-running animated series King of the Hill .
